Get started19 Queens Road is a five-bedroom semi-detached house in Haywards Heath (RH16 1EH). It has a recorded floor area of 164 m² (around 1765 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band E. The latest certificate (August 2017) shows a D (score 66),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in March 2009 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Average to Good, hot-water efficiency went from Average to Good and main heating went from Average to Good.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 78).
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 8%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£719,000 is 21.9% above the 2019 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£334/sq ft) was about 38.9%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 164 m² the property is well over the postcode median (106 m² across 12 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. 5 bedrooms is on the larger side for this postcode, where 4 is the typical count. Sold November 2019 for £590,000.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. One historical planning record sits against the property in 2016.
